Cross Platform Web Design
Technologies on the web evolve quickly. Every year brings new devices and with them new capabilities. These devices present many challenges and opportunities to web developers. Students review fundamentals of web development using hypertext markup language (HTML), and cascading style sheets (CSS), with a focus on developing responsive and mobile websites. Multiple IDEs are introduced and used to complete hands-on projects.
Course Highlights
-
HTML
Students learn the core concepts of HTML needed to build well structured, accessible websites.
-
CSS
Students learn how to create responsive layouts through modern CSS best practices.
-
Git & GitHub
Students learn and utilize Git and GitHub to back up, share, and publish their code online.
-
TailwindCSS
Students learn TailwindCSS to help streamline styling and create consistent theming.
